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- SAINT DOCTRINE:
- • TDD, start with integrations tests
- • Use Service Objects for interaction between several models
- • all texts to i18n (in multilingual projects)
- • all bootstrap elements to own CSS classes (grids & utilities are exeptions)
- • use BEM methodology for naming CSS classes
- • no CSS in HTML
- • no JavaScript in HTML
- • no new gems/libraries without agreement
- • it's forbidden to edit migrations
- • no "if", methods, logic in migrations
- • no objects in service params
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ement